Pricing Breakdown
Midjourney
Basic: $10/month (~200 generations). Standard: $30/month (15 fast hours, unlimited relaxed). Pro: $60/month (30 fast hours, stealth mode). Mega: $120/month (60 fast hours).
ProtoPie
Individual: $13/month. Team: $21/month per seat. Enterprise: custom. 30-day free trial.

Midjourney
Pros
- + Highest aesthetic quality among AI image generators
- + Strong cinematic and photorealistic output
- + Active community sharing prompts and techniques
- + Frequent model updates with major quality leaps
Cons
- - Discord-only interface is unintuitive for many users
- - No free tier — starts at $10/month
- - Limited control over composition compared to Stable Diffusion
- - Usage rights require paid subscription
ProtoPie
Pros
- + Most realistic prototypes without code
- + Multi-device interaction support
- + Imports directly from Figma/Sketch
- + Powerful conditional logic
Cons
- - No free plan — 30-day trial only
- - Steeper learning curve than simpler tools
- - Desktop app required for editing
- - Expensive for solo users
